was a Roman amphitheatre in , , England. Its remains are scheduled as an ancient monument. Archaeological digs have uncovered the earthworks, revealing the outline of the construction, which is still visible, with the banking reaching 25 feet from the bottom of the arena. is situated 1,300 feet north of Lawrence Road.
